Chewy’s Bold Push into Vet Clinics Could Unlock a $40 Billion Market, Says Morgan Stanley
Chewy Inc. (NYSE:CHWY) has emerged as Morgan Stanley’s top pick to capitalize on the U.S. veterinary clinic boom, as the investment bank estimates the market is worth approximately $40 billion in total addressable opportunity.
In a new report, analysts at Morgan Stanley launched a detailed model projecting Chewy’s clinic expansion strategy. They estimate that every 100 clinics could generate $50 million in EBITDA, creating $500 million to $800 million in enterprise value (EV) — even before accounting for broader branding and customer acquisition benefits.
Why Chewy?
Morgan Stanley's confidence in Chewy’s competitive edge is grounded in a few key drivers:
Strong brand loyalty among pet owners
Over $3 billion in existing pet health sales, including the largest U.S. pet pharmacy
Large, data-rich customer base with millions of recurring orders
A growing affinity among millennials and Gen Z pet owners, 80% of whom say they would consider Chewy-run vet clinics
Clinic-Level Economics
Here’s what the numbers look like per clinic, according to Morgan Stanley:
Metric
Per Clinic Estimate
Annual Revenue
~$2.4 million
EBITDA at Maturity
~$500,000
Enterprise Value (EV) Impact
$5M – $8M
Capital Investment
~$1.5M – $2.0M
Expected ROI
~2.5x – 5x
Morgan Stanley models a base case where Chewy opens 100 clinics by 2030, yielding:
$290 million in revenue
$47 million in EBITDA
In its bull case, Chewy scales to 275 clinics, generating:
$842 million in revenue
$126 million in EBITDA
In line with these projections, Morgan Stanley raised its bull-case price target for Chewy from $68 to $75 per share.
